A recent study published in Nature Communications has provided new insights into the relationship between F-Actin accumulation and brain aging, utilizing fruit flies as a model organism. F-Actin, a polymerized form of the actin protein, plays a crucial role in various cellular functions, including maintaining the structure of neurons and supporting their health [1].
